web的各种前端打印方法之CSS控制网页打印样式
掌控网页打印样式的CSS秘籍
你是否曾在CSS控制打印样式的世界时感到迷茫?刚开始,我对CSS中的media属性一无所知,每当他人提及导入某个样式时,我总是手足无措。如果你也有过这样的经历,那么让我带你走进W3school的世界,了解media属性的奥秘。
media属性的定义与魔法:在CSS中,media属性是一个强大的工具,它决定了你的网页样式将在何种设备上呈现。通过media属性,你可以为不同的媒介类型定制不同的样式。要使用media来指定CSS的媒体类型,你需要了解它的基本语法结构。
media属性有着多种类型,如screen、print、projection、braille、aural、tv、handheld以及all。每一种类型都有其特定的应用场景。
screen:主要针对计算机屏幕。
print:适用于打印机等印刷设备。
projection:用于展示项目,如幻灯机或大屏幕投影。
braille:适用于盲文系统,为触觉印刷品提供样式。
aural:为语音电子合成器定义样式。
tv和handheld则分别针对电视类型和手持式显示设备。
如果你想在打印时隐藏某些内容,可以使用media属性来导入特定的CSS样式表。例如,你可以创建一个名为“print.css”的样式表,专门针对打印媒体定义样式。然后,通过以下代码将其链接到你的网页中:
```html
```
你还可以在HTML文档的
```
这样,当用户在浏览器中执行打印操作时,你定义的打印样式就会生效,而原本在屏幕上显示的样式则不会出现在打印页面上。掌握了这一技巧,你就能轻松掌控网页的打印样式,让网页在各种场景下都展现出最佳效果。
网站源码
- web的各种前端打印方法之CSS控制网页打印样式
- 三星开始研发连接Galaxy设备的虚拟现实头盔
- Win10蓝牙在哪里?Win10蓝牙设置关闭或开启方法图
- 无线网连不上怎么办?笔记本连不上无线网解决
- 在Win10中怎么将库添加到资源管理器默认打开位置
- Dreamweaver CS6超链接怎么去掉下划线- dw取消字体下
- 网易财经APP新版本发布:猜涨跌助战后市
- win10系统关机后电脑自动开机该怎么办?
- Apple Watch需求放缓 可穿戴设备发展思考
- HTML5 创建canvas元素示例代码
- ai怎么设计男式衬衫的图标- ai画衬衫矢量图的教
- SpamSubtract.exe - SpamSubtract是什么进程
- CorelDRAW 绘制逼真的折扇
- Win10网卡驱动检测不到怎么办 网卡驱动不能用解
- 百度极速搜索模式是什么?怎么用?
- Html5让容器充满屏幕高度或自适应剩余高度的布局